Some players may experience crashes or freezing. This may be caused by outdated or unsupported hardware specifications as the game is built on Unreal Engine 5
Night Shippers currently does not support Linux or macOS systems
Night Shippers uses a peer-to-peer (P2P) networking system. For the best experience, make sure the host has the most stable and strongest internet connection
Fixed an issue where cosmetic helmets could block the flashlight in first person camera
Fixed a collision bug after interacting with the hammock
Fixed an issue where players could sometimes take damage in the Lobby and Rest Stops
Updated layout of the Walled City map for improved navigation
Reduced cursed contract chance multiplier from 15% → 8% per day
Reduced Doll Legs damage from 10 → 4 per second
Reduced locked door spawn chance from 35% → 25%
Lowered overall game difficulty while slightly increasing early game entity spawns
Buffed delivery time for 5-star orders
Reduced weather event chances in early-game maps
Added a new lootable related to Doll Legs
Gacha boxes can now rarely drop shotguns and rifles
Increased spawn chances of shotguns and lockpicks in VIP zone shops by 4%
Updated textures for some items and cosmetics
Fix some small localization issue
We’ve been watching streamers play Night Shippers during the first few hours after launch. It’s been great seeing the fun but we’ve also noticed some common points of confusion. Here’s a quick Q&A to help clear things up:
Straw Effigy Ritual: The Straw Effigy must be placed in the pot, not on the plate at the reviving altar.
(Fail the ritual and… yeah, your friend is staying in hell.)
Citizen (Zombie-looking guy): Their AI may feel “off,” but that’s intentional. They’re designed to be dumb, so players can lure them into traps or holes.
Energy Regeneration: Energy regen is intentionally slow. You’re meant to refill it with food and drinks and manage it carefully.
Map Unlocking: Maps are permanently unlocked within a save file once obtained.
Yellow area on minimap: That area will indicate that your customer might be somewhere in that zones. We are also reducing its size.
That said, these are just our design intentions and we might be wrong sometimes 👀
